I have recently installed ns3-gym. |
run test_tcp.py which in rl-tcp,some problems occurred.
the code will stuck at this line:
env = ns3env.Ns3Env(port=port, stepTime=stepTime, startSim=startSim, simSeed=seed, simArgs=simArgs, debug=debug)
i use keyboard to interrput:
file "/Users/lyf2481/workspace/ns-allinone-3.33/ns-3.33/contrib/opengym/ns3-gym-master/scratch/rl-tcp/test_tcp.py", line 37, in
env = ns3env.Ns3Env()
File "/usr/local/lib/python3.9/site-packages/ns3gym/ns3env.py", line 381, in init
self.ns3ZmqBridge.initialize_env(self.stepTime)
File "/usr/local/lib/python3.9/site-packages/ns3gym/ns3env.py", line 151, in initialize_env
request = self.socket.recv()
File "zmq/backend/cython/socket.pyx", line 781, in zmq.backend.cython.socket.Socket.recv
File "zmq/backend/cython/socket.pyx", line 817, in zmq.backend.cython.socket.Socket.recv
File "zmq/backend/cython/socket.pyx", line 186, in zmq.backend.cython.socket._recv_copy
File "zmq/backen
And i want to ask how to solve this problem,thanks a lot
